Congratulations to the Distinguished Alumni 2009 recipients! They will be honored during Alumni Weekend at the Distinguished Alumni Dinner on Friday, May 1. More details on Alumni Weekend will be available in March.
Rob Brown '79 has over twenty years of sales and marketing experience at Eli Lilly and Company. He currently holds the position of Vice President - Chief Marketing & Operations Officer for the U.S. affiliate and oversees the marketing planning and strategies for Lilly's entire portfolio.
LeAnne Smith Hardy '69, author and freelance editor, has lived in six countries on four continents. She teaches writing and writes for children affected by HIV/AIDS. Her publications include The Wooden Ox, Between Two Worlds, So That's What God is Like, and Glastonbury Tor, all published by Kregel in the United States.
John Krauss '67 joined the faculty of the Indiana University School of Public and Environmental Affairs as a clinical professor in 2003 and is also an adjunct professor of law at the Indiana University School of Law-Indianapolis. He is the director of the Center for Urban Policy and the Environment and the Indiana University Public Policy Institute.
